    I realise that Norm's study is entirely based on German Manufacture,and Vienna.

    I thought,seeing as Bacqueville of Paris was mentioned,perhaps we could include Yokohama,Japan.

    Yes i know,only a Hilfskreuzer collector would bring this up. :whistle:

    But HK awards were produced by an unknown jeweler in Yokohama and awarded to crewmen of the HK's serving in the Far East,namely the THOR and MICHEL.

    Unlike the Baqueville badges we do have photographic evidence of the Japanese made awards being worn.

    This would complete the list of cities involved in KM award manufacture,i think. :rolleyes:
